Heating mantles are essential devices used to prevent heat loss and improve the efficiency of heating systems. These unique and innovative solutions provide an effective way to retain heat and save energy. A heating jacket is an insulating cover that is placed around pipes, tanks or other heating equipment. It is designed to reduce heat loss by creating a barrier between the heat source and the environment. This ensures that the heat is retained and not lost to the environment, increasing the efficiency of the heating system. These sheaths are made of high-quality materials such as fiberglass, ceramic fibers or other insulating materials. They are designed to withstand high temperatures and provide excellent thermal insulation properties. This allows them to keep the heat inside the jacket and prevent it from leaking out. Heating mantles are often used in industrial environments where heat loss can be a major problem. For example, they are used in chemical factories, refineries, power plants and other installations where heat-intensive processes take place. By using heating jackets, companies can achieve significant energy savings and reduce operating costs. In addition to reducing heat loss, heating jackets also provide protection against frostbite. In cold environments, pipes and tanks can freeze, leading to damage and malfunctions. By using heating jackets, companies can effectively address this problem and improve the reliability of their heating systems. Heating mantles are available in different sizes and shapes, making them suitable for different applications. They are easy to install and maintain, making them a cost-effective solution for improving the energy efficiency of heating systems.
